DESCRIPTION:Appointed by the BIFA Board of Directors\, Policy Groups are representative Working Committees\, as are necessary for the promotion of specialised interests and activities of BIFA Members and Regulations. \nThe BIFA Air Policy Group focuses on issues related to air freight and the broader air cargo industry. The group provides a platform for members to engage in discussions about industry trends\, regulatory changes\, and operational challenges specific to air transport. By collaborating with IATA and FIATA\, airports\, and regulatory authorities\, the group ensures that BIFA members’ interests are represented and that the air freight sector remains efficient and compliant. \nPLEASE NOTE: This is a closed group and operates on a strict invite-only policy. DESCRIPTION:In view of the changing nature of the business activities of many BIFA members\, BIFA conducted a thorough review of its Standard Trading Conditions (STC) during the first half of 2025. In addition\, the recent legislative changes stemming from the UK leaving the European Union and increasing friction in global trade have necessitated a number of amendments. \nThe review was led by BIFA’s Legal and Insurance Policy Group in consultation with solicitors\, insurers and the wider BIFA Membership.  The review resulted in the biggest rewrite of the BIFA STC since they were originally published in 1988. In this webinar\, Robert Windsor will present the 2025 conditions to Members\, pointing out the most significant changes to the wording of clauses and the potential impacts on Members’ business. \nThe new conditions will be the only valid BIFA STC after 31 December 2025. Members will be reminded that the STC must be properly incorporated into all customer contracts in order that the member benefits from the protections offered and that the new terms must be brought to the attention of all existing customers. Insurers and any overseas agents must also be advised of the switch to the new set of conditions. \nBOOK NOW \nCopies of all relevant documents relating to the rewritten STC will be available on the BIFA website.
